In response to the limitations of GDP, several alternative and complementary measures have been developed. The Genuine Progress Indicator (GPI) and the Human Development Index (HDI) are examples of metrics that attempt to provide a more holistic view of economic performance and societal well-being. The GPI adjusts GDP for factors like income inequality and environmental degradation, while the HDI focuses on health, education, and standard of living.
